Awards season is Yoo Jungin full swing! Fresh off the 2023 Golden Globes, the Screen Actors Guild has announced the nominees for this year's SAG Awards. These selections often set the tone for the acting categories at the Academy Awards, as all four winners in the individual film categories at last year's SAG Awards went on to win the Oscar.
The Banshees of Inisherinand Everything Everywhere All At Oncehave emerged as heavyweight contenders, each picking up four nominations in individual categories and a nomination for Best Ensemble. Golden Globe winners like Cate Blanchett, Michelle Yeoh, Colin Farrell, and Austin Butler will have a chance to repeat their wins.
SEE ALSO: The complete list of winners at the 2023 Golden GlobesOn the television side, newly minted Golden Globe winner for Best Drama Series, House of the Dragon,was shut out everywhere except in the Stunt Ensemble category, leaving the race wide open for shows like Severanceand Better Call Saul.
